Using v2.5

 

Hi, i am hoping to get some assistance in making a quiz where the scenario will be like:

 

•For each sub-topic, we have a questions from question bank (around 10)

•If the student gets 3 correct in a row he moves to the next sub-topic

•If the students doesn't get 3 correct, he continues until he gets either 5 correct in total or 3 correct in a row (whichever is first)

•If he reaches the end of the questions and did not get 3 correct in a row or 5 correct in total, he still progresses to the next sub-topic questions.

Re: Quiz Scenario

by Alexandro Colorado -

First one should be easy, just prepare your questions bank into blocks and assign to each type of quiz for each type of topic.

The second could be a 33% = approved. However... The behaviour is not there to recognize the 3 questions were in a row, I assume that you could do it more manually by breaking it down into 2 quizes, if you pass the first, you are except from the second.
